Breast Implants
7-year deflation rate data filed for breast implants post approval survey study
September 5th, 2004
INAMED Corporation (IMDC) has filed 7-year deflation rate follow-up data with the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) for augmentation and reconstruction patients who are participating in the core clinical study of its Biocell Textured and Smooth Saline-Filled Breast Implants. The 7-year data are an interval update for product labeling that is required by the FDA as part of the Post Approval Survey Study that was a condition of approval for Inamed's saline-filled breast implants in 2000.
